Zach Galifianakis would like The Hangover sequel to be set in Moscow.

Galifianakis is all set to reprise the role of Alan alongside Bradley Cooper, Justin Bartha and Ed Helms as filmmaker Todd Philips is also returning to the project.

The Hangover was one of the unexpected hits of last summer as the movie went on to top the box office, win over the critics, and went on to take over $467 million at the global box office.

And while the original was set in Las Vegas Galifianakis would like to see the sequel set in the Russian capital.

Speaking to Entertainment Weekly he said: "I think Russia would be amazing. The first Hangover worked because it was Vegas, but it was the dirty side of Vegas, not the glitzy one.

"You’ve got to put the characters against danger. So they could get involved in organised crime in Moscow, which I think is incredibly scary."

However he revealed that the producers already had several locations in mind "Where it is going to take place is beautiful. They probably will show the dirty part of the beauty. I think that’s the goal."

Galifianakis is back on the big screen this year as he reunites with Philips for a new comedy Due Date, which also stars Oscar nominee and Iron Man actor Robert Downey Jr.
